PHP mysqli_commit function ()
Podręcznik PHP MySQLi referencyjny
Przykłady
Wyłącz auto-commit, zrobić kilka zapytań, a następnie przesłać zapytanie:
<? Php
// Zakłada, że nazwa użytkownika bazy danych: root, hasło: 123456, bazy danych: w3big
$ Con = mysqli_connect ( "localhost" , "root", "123456", "w3big");
if (mysqli_connect_errno ($ con))
{
echo "Połączenie MySQL nie powiodło się:" mysqli_connect_error () ;.
}
// Close AUTOCOMMIT
mysqli_autocommit ($ con, FALSE);
// Insert jakąś wartość
mysqli_query ($ con "INSERT INTO internetowych (nazwa, adres URL, Alexa, kraj)
VALUES ( '', 'Baidu https: //www.baidu.com/','4','CN') ");
// Commit transakcję
mysqli_commit ($ con);
// Zamknięcie połączenia
mysqli_close ($ con);
?>
// Zakłada, że nazwa użytkownika bazy danych: root, hasło: 123456, bazy danych: w3big
$ Con = mysqli_connect ( "localhost" , "root", "123456", "w3big");
if (mysqli_connect_errno ($ con))
{
echo "Połączenie MySQL nie powiodło się:" mysqli_connect_error () ;.
}
// Close AUTOCOMMIT
mysqli_autocommit ($ con, FALSE);
// Insert jakąś wartość
mysqli_query ($ con "INSERT INTO internetowych (nazwa, adres URL, Alexa, kraj)
VALUES ( '', 'Baidu https: //www.baidu.com/','4','CN') ");
// Commit transakcję
mysqli_commit ($ con);
// Zamknięcie połączenia
mysqli_close ($ con);
?>
Definicja i Wykorzystanie
Funkcja mysqli_commit () zobowiązuje bieżącej transakcji określonego połączenia z bazą danych.
Porada: Sprawdź mysqli_autocommit () Funkcja ta służy do włączania lub wyłączania zmian auto-commit bazy danych. Zobacz mysqli_rollback () Funkcja ta służy do przywrócić bieżącą transakcję.
gramatyka
mysqli_commit( connection ) ;
参数 | 描述 |
---|---|
connection | 必需。规定要使用的 MySQL 连接。 |
dane techniczne
Zwraca: | W przypadku powodzenia zwraca TRUE, w przypadku niepowodzenia zwraca FALSE. |
---|---|
Wersja PHP: | 5+ |
Podręcznik PHP MySQLi referencyjny